CATWOMAN #76
DC Comics
0325DC119
0325DC120 – Catwoman #76 Frank Cho Cover – $4.99
0325DC121 – Catwoman #76 Inhyuk Lee Cover – $4.99
(W) Torunn Gronbekk (A) Patricio Delpeche (CA) Sebastian Fiumara
CATWOMAN ON THE BRINK! As Catwoman’s life hangs in the balance, Selina’s mind drifts back to her final days as Evie Hall and the deadly events that led her to discard that identity and return to Gotham City.
In Shops: 5/21/2025
SRP: $3.99
